I'm looking for info/tips/products that would help me transfer work
between Macintosh systems and IBM-PC's.  I have previously surveyed
LAN possibilities that accomodate both and I'm aware of most of the
various telecommunications software available for both machines.
What I'm trying to get at is the problem of converting various IBM
based word processors (such as Wordstar and Wordperfect) to MacWrite
etc. on the Mac side.  Also, for spreadsheets and graphics data, etc.
I relalise there must be some hard limitations due to the hardware
differences, etc. between the two systems but I would expec there to
be some useful products available in this area.  Also, I know that 
Microsoft Word and a few other programs exist in both the Mac and PC
worlds... are their files compatible once transferred?

BTW, I'm also aware of "MacCharlie" and similar products.  I assume there
must be something to read Mac disks on a suitablely equiped PC.  But this
still leaves one with problems at the software level.
